Output 92a84f34086d32d18af2759bd2ae83ccae8995246f26cbfa5af35dd4e53787b2:37

value
4317232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 151f53023c0a15634175b4ed07d4a562d111d4ef OP_EQUAL
address
33che25dsBStsBkDDNSPwfUSahmYtFDmhz
transaction
92a84f34086d32d18af2759bd2ae83ccae8995246f26cbfa5af35dd4e53787b2
confirmations
386035
spent
true